随着互联网的不断发展,数字身份的重要性越来越凸显。在传统互联网中,我们的身份依赖于中心化的服务提供商,如社交媒体、银行和其他在线服务。然而,Web3的到来带来了全新的思路,身份不再依赖于单一的服务提供商,而是在去中心化的环境下,由用户自主控制。本文将深入探讨Web3身份证明的概念、技术基础、应用场景及其潜在的影响。

什么是Web3身份证明?

Web3身份证明是通过去中心化技术(尤其是区块链)来建立和管理数字身份的一种方式。在Web3环境中,用户能够完全控制自己的身份信息,而不需要依赖于中心化的平台。Web3身份证明的核心理念是“自我主权身份”(SSI),它允许用户在不依赖中介的情况下,验证和证明自己的身份。

在传统互联网中,用户的身份信息通常储存在中心化的数据库中,这意味着用户的个人信息面临被泄露、滥用的风险。而在Web3中,用户的身份信息加密存储在区块链上,只有用户自己才能访问和共享这些信息。同时,Web3也允许用户选择性地分享自己的身份信息,从而保护隐私。

Web3身份证明的技术基础

Web3身份证明:未来数字身份的构建与应用

Web3身份证明的实现依赖于多种技术,其中最核心的是区块链技术和去中心化身份(DID)标准。区块链技术提供了一个透明、安全和不可更改的环境,使得身份信息的存储和管理变得更加可靠。

去中心化身份(DID)是一种新兴的身份标准,它允许用户创建自己的身份标识符,并通过区块链进行管理。用户可以使用DID来生成数字身份证明,例如学历证明、工作经历等。这些证明可以由相关机构进行签名,从而提高其可信度。与传统身份证明不同,DID和相关证明可以在多个平台之间使用,增强了身份的流动性和适用性。

Web3身份证明的应用场景

Web3身份证明的潜在应用场景非常广泛,涵盖了金融、医疗、教育等多个领域。在金融领域,Web3身份证明可以用于进行KYC(了解客户)验证,减少金融诈骗的风险。在医疗领域,患者可以使用数字身份来控制自己的医疗记录,确保只有授权的医疗机构才能访问这些信息。

在教育领域,Web3身份证明可以为学生提供不可篡改的学历和成绩证明,雇主可以通过区块链验证候选人的教育背景。此外,Web3身份证明还可以在社交网络中应用,用户可以选择分享哪些信息,哪些人可以看到,从而增强隐私保护。

如何构建Web3身份?

Web3身份证明:未来数字身份的构建与应用

构建Web3身份的过程通常包括几个步骤:选择合适的区块链平台、创建和管理去中心化身份(DID)、生成和存储身份证明,以及确保安全性和隐私。用户可以选择使用以太坊、Polkadot等区块链平台来创建身份。

一旦选择了平台,用户将创建自己的DID,并通过智能合约生成与其相关的身份证明。存储方面,用户可以选择去中心化存储解决方案,例如IPFS(星际文件系统)来保存身份相关的信息。最后,用户需要确保自己的私钥安全,以防止身份被盗用。

Web3身份证明的潜在挑战

尽管Web3身份证明具有众多优势,但在实际应用中也面临一些挑战。首先,技术的复杂性可能会阻碍普通用户的普及。大多数普通用户对区块链和去中心化技术并不熟悉,这可能导致他们在使用Web3身份证明时感到困惑。

其次,法律和法规的缺乏也是一个重要挑战。由于Web3身份证明是一个相对新的领域,许多国家和地区尚未建立相应的法律框架来管理去中心化身份和数据保护。这可能导致用户在使用Web3身份证明时面临法律风险。

最后,安全性和隐私问题依然是任何数字身份系统需要面对的核心问题。尽管区块链技术具有较高的安全性,但一旦用户私钥被盗,身份信息将受到极大风险。因此,如何保护用户的私钥和身份信息将是Web3身份证明未来需要重点解决的问题。

常见问题解答

Web3身份证明与传统身份有什么区别?

Web3身份证明与传统身份的主要区别在于去中心化的管理方式。在传统身份系统中,用户的身份信息通常存储在中心化的数据库中,用户对这些信息没有完全的控制权。而在Web3中,用户通过去中心化身份(DID)能够自主管理自己的身份信息,从而更好地保护隐私,也减少了身份信息泄露的风险。

此外,Web3身份证明允许用户更细粒度地控制身份信息的共享,例如可以选择性地分享某些信息,而不需要一次性分享所有信息。这一特性使得Web3身份证明在保障隐私的同时,也能满足不同场景下的需求。

Web3身份证明如何影响隐私保护?

Web3身份证明通过去中心化和自我主权的设计,极大地提升了用户对个人隐私的保护。在传统中心化系统中,用户的个人信息经常被收集、存储并可能被用于商业目的。而Web3身份证明则允许用户完全控制自己的身份信息,只有在用户明确授权的情况下,其他方才能访问这些信息。

这意味着用户可以决定分享哪些身份信息,分享给谁,并且可以随时收回对某些信息的授权。这种掌控权不仅增强了用户的隐私保护,也提高了信息共享的安全性。此外,Web3身份证明的设计使得所有的身份证明都能在链上可追溯,减少了身份信息被篡改的可能性。

如何验证Web3身份证明的有效性?

验证Web3身份证明的有效性可以通过多种方式进行。首先,区块链的透明性和不可篡改性使得身份信息的验证过程变得简单。用户可以通过区块链浏览器查询与其DID相关的身份证明,以确定这些信息的真实性。

其次,第三方验证机构在Web3身份证明中也扮演着重要角色。用户可以选择将自己的身份证明交由某个去中心化的验证机构进行签名和认证。这些机构使用公钥加密技术生成的签名可以被广泛验证,确保身份证明的可信度。

最后,用户自己的社交网络也可以用于验证身份信息。例如,用户可以要求朋友或同事为自己的某个身份证明背书,从而在社交平台上增加自己的可信度。

Web3身份证明的未来发展趋势是什么?

Web3身份证明的未来发展趋势可能会集中在技术创新、用户体验和法规合规等方面。在技术创新上,随着区块链技术的不断迭代,Web3身份证明将在安全性和效率上得到进一步提高。例如,跨链技术的进步将使得不同区块链之间能够进行身份信息的互通,为用户提供更大的灵活性。

用户体验方面,开发者需要致力于简化Web3身份证明的使用流程,使得普通用户能够方便地创建和管理自己的数字身份。同时,教育用户关于Web3身份证明的知识也是重要的,以降低技术使用壁垒。

在法规合规上,各国政府需要制定相应的法律框架,以确保Web3身份证明的合规性,保障用户的合法权益。这将促进Web3身份证明的健康发展,使其能被广泛应用到更多领域。

Web3身份证明是否适用于所有人?

Web3身份证明虽然具有诸多优势,但并非所有人都能迅速适应和掌握。首先,技术使用的复杂性对普通用户仍是一个不小的障碍。尽管Web3的目标是去中心化和用户友好,但在技术实现上,例如私钥的管理、区块链平台的选择等,仍需一定的技术素养。

其次,网络和设备的可获得性也是适用性的一个因素。在一些发展中国家,互联网接入和数字设备并不普及,这使得Web3身份证明在这些地区的普及面临挑战。此外,教育和培训也是重要的考虑因素,用户需要相应的知识以理解和使用Web3身份证明。

尽管如此,随着技术的不断进步和易用性的提高,Web3身份证明有潜力逐步覆盖更广泛的人群,并为他们带来更好的数字身份管理体验。

综上所述,Web3身份证明作为未来数字身份管理的一个重要方向,展现出了广阔的应用前景。通过去中心化、用户主权的方式,Web3身份证明不仅能够提升身份信息的安全性和隐私保护,还能为用户提供更便捷和高效的身份管理解决方案,预示着数字身份的未来将会更加自主和安全。